For the first card, I used the crisp dye inks to sponge some inks onto white cardstock. Now run this piece through the bigshot machine using the 3D embossing folder. Love love the details I got. Gently rub white pigment ink to this piece so the raised ares will catch the ink. Sprinkle WOW! clear sparkle embossing glitter and heat emboss. This give a beautiful glittery shine to some of the raised areas.

 
Stamp the sentiment onto white cardstock. Die-cut it using the shaped die. Now keeping the die in it's place sponge some inks to match the mat layer. Adhere to the card using 3d foam.
 

For the next card, I took a deep red card layer, sponged some midnight violet crisp and a bit of blak ink to the edges. Sponge the violet ink through the Sketched Lines Stencil. Stamp the floral image using the Platinum embossing powder. Add in the color using the stencils. Add details using the white gel pen.

 
Stamp and emboss the sentiment using the Platinum embossing powder. Adhere to the card using 3d foam and to finish some sequins.

I have two cards using the Craft-A-Flower: Magnolia for you today. I went for the mixed media technique for both of them.
 
 
For my first card, I applied some distress oxide inks to the gelli plate, smoothen it using a brayer and took a print onto white cardstock. I then sponged Altenew crisp ink through the broken Cheverons Stencil. Deboss this panel using the Dotted Swirls Debossing cover die. Die-cut two pieces of the Lace die. Adhere to the panel. Die-cut all the elements of the Magnolia flower and leaves from watercolor paper. Add color using the Artists watercolor. Adhere to the card.
 

Card 2

 
For my next card, I started by adding some color to a watercolor panel using the Artists watercolor. Apply Altenew embossing paste through the Tree Ring stencil. Sprinkle WOW! Fools gold embossing powder. Heat emboss. Die-cut all the elements of the Magnolia flower and leaves from watercolor paper. Add color using the Artists watercolor. Adhere to the card.

Hello everyone!Today, I am sharing a fun and cute card using a mix of stamps, dies and stencil on the Heffy Doodle blog.

 
I started by creating a background by sponging kitsch flamingo distress through the Scribble On My Heart stencil. Dab the ink pad to the craft mat, flick water using a wet brush.

Die-cut the tree trunk, greenery from the Tree-mendous Peekaboo Tree Dies, run the trunk through the die-cutting machine using the Woodgrain Texture Background die for a lovely texture. Sponge antique linen and vintage photo distress inks to the trunk. Sponge twisted citron and mowed lawn distress oxide inks to the greenery. Flick some ink for added texture.
 

Die-cut grass using the Grassy Lass border dies, sponge green distress oxide inks.

Stamp images, colour using copic markers and die-cut using the coordinating dies.

Nuts About You Stamp and Dies - bird feeder, birds

Deer To Me Stamp and Dies - Deer, sentiment

Quill You Be Mine Stamp and Dies - hedge hog, flowers, sentiment
 

Stamp the sentiments and assemble the card using 3d foam for added dimension.

I have five cards for you today. The first three cards use the same stamp set "Folk Garden 2" This truly has so many possibilities :)
For the first card I used the
Folk Garden 2 stamp along with the Folk Garden 2 layering Stencils and the Folk Garden 2 dies, Brushed Sentiments hot foil plate, dies.



Stamp the image, add color using the layering stencils. I used Candy Apple, Berrylicious, Sparkling Rose, Bubble Gum, Clementine, Yellows and Brown. Die-cut using the coordinating dies. Take a dark red cardbase and sponge some berrylicious ink to the edges. Adhere the images to the card using 3d foam towards the edges. Flick gold paint. Foil the sentiment using the hot foil plate with Spellbinders glimmer machine and gold matt foil. Die-cut using the dies. Die-cut one more piece using pink cardstock. Adhere behind the foiled sentiment, slightly offset. Adhere to the card.


 
For the 2nd. card, I used a peach cardstock and used the Folk Garden 2 foil plate. I then foiled the image using pink foil. Add white pigment ink through the Folk Garden 2 layering Stencils, let dry. Now add color using the passion fruit, clementine, yellow, candy apple, meadow, evergreen inks. Die-cut the image using the Folk Garden 2 dies. Adhere the images to a white card layer. Add dimension to the leaves and florals by simply shaping them a bit.



Stamp the sentiment from the Daisy Slimline stamp and adhere to the card.
 
 

Next, I went with no line watercolor look using the same
Folk Garden 2 stamp.Stamp the image using Peach fuzz ink, Color using zig brush markers. Die-cut the image using the Folk Garden 2 dies.
Take a watercolor layer, apply crackle paste to it through the
Leafy Squares stencil. Let dry. Add watercolor in pink. Add some flicks of pink and gold. Adhere the image to the layer using 3D foam. Die-cut a frame using the Slim Stitched Scalloped Rectangles. Adhere behind the mat layer. Adhere this to the card.
Foil the sentiment using gold matt foil, die-cut. Now backing it with a vellum circle, adhere to the card.


 
To finish, add some iridescent crystals from Studio Katia.



For the next card, I used the Darling Dahlias stamp set and the coordinating Layering Stencils. What I like about the stencils is the it can cover the images so I could add color to the background too. Easy Peasy...lol. Flick white paint.

I used inks in Sky Blue, Seaside, Storm, Bubble Gum, Raspberry Bliss, Meadow to add color to the image. Now, I used the layering Stencil from the Brushed Sentiments...Oh! I love the effect so much. Die-cut using the coordinating dies

 
 
Die-cut the scalloped using slimline scalloped rectangle, adhere vellum behind it. Add the sentiment using 3d foam and backed with white floss
 

For the last card, I used the Daisy Slimline Frame stamp, emboss it using WOW! silver embossing powder. Add color using the layering stencils and cut the center using the coordinating die. take a watercolor mar layer, apply crackle paste through the Leafy Squares stencil, let dry. Add some blue, pink and orange ink for some color.


 
Adhere the frame to this layer using 3D foam. Adhere to a white card. Stamp the sentiment in black and add some Icy Sparkle crystals by Studio Katia.
